Pint pour on draught at the brewery. Served in a Will Becher glass. It pours an almost clear, grassy golden yellow color with a modest, milk white head and minimal lacing. Its smell includes lemon peel, coriander, and faint spicy hops. The taste is crisp with tart lemon over a crackery malt base. The Belgian farmhouse spicing is evident but mellow. The mouth feel is very lite with lively carbonation, and at 4.3% ABV it is extremely drinkable. Overall, Wash is a nice change of pace beer and I commend Autodidact for brewing the rather obscure style of Grisette.
